Embedded Technology: A Game-Changer In The Digital World

Embedded technology refers to integrating hardware and software components in a single device, creating a system that performs specific functions.

It is the backbone of many modern-day devices, ranging from smartphones to cars and home appliances. Embedded technology has become an integral part of our daily lives, and its applications are expanding exponentially.

Introduction To Embedded Technology

Embedded technology can be defined as a system with a dedicated function within a larger system. This type of technology is found in almost every electronic device we use today.

It's a sophisticated technology that includes microcontrollers, microprocessors, sensors, and other electronic components that make up a particular product.

Applications Of Embedded Technology

The applications of embedded technology are vast and diverse, ranging from everyday devices to specialised systems. Smartphones, tablets, and laptops are just a few examples of embedded technology.

Cars today are full of embedded systems, from GPS navigation and infotainment systems to safety features like lane departure warnings and adaptive cruise control.

Home appliances are another area where embedded technology has revolutionised our lives. Smart refrigerators, washing machines, and air conditioning systems can communicate with each other and with the internet, allowing users to control and monitor them remotely.

Benefits Of Embedded Technology

The advantages of embedded technology are numerous. It allows for the automation of tasks, making our lives easier and more convenient. It also improves efficiency, accuracy, and safety in many industries.

In the healthcare sector, embedded technology is used to monitor vital signs and provide real-time feedback to doctors and patients. This has the potential to revolutionise the way we manage chronic conditions and prevent medical emergencies.

Embedded technology also has the potential to improve safety in industries such as aviation and transportation. Using sensors and other embedded systems can help detect and prevent accidents.

Future Of Embedded Technology

The future of embedded technology is exciting and full of potential. With the growth of the Internet of Things (IoT), we can expect more and more devices to be connected and integrated, leading to a smarter and more interconnected world.

The use of artificial intelligence and machine learning in embedded systems is another area where we can expect significant advancements. These technologies can improve the performance and functionality of embedded systems, leading to new and innovative applications.
